Thank you for popping in to see the next little gift idea one could make ahead of time... some coasters using Simple Stories 'Cozy Christmas'. These would make a lovely seasonal gift or a sweet addition to your festive table setting. 
 * To start, you will need a 12x12 chipboard sheet.
The squares I have used have been trimmed down to 4x4inches each.
* Next, I have taken some decoupage paint (this is just a cheapie one) 
and painted all over the surface of the chipboard, 
paying special attention to the edges and corners.
* Using the leftovers from a pack of Sn@p cards, I have taken a couple 
of 4x6 ones and adhered them to the wet chipboard. 
Smooth out well to remove any air bubles. Repeat this process with all 
of the 'A' sides. For the 'B' sides, I have used a dark wood print
I think this gives a nice uniformity. You could of course, have pattern 
on both sides or you could even try using cork paper for the bottom.
* Once all the papers have been adhered, go ahead and embellish the top. I would only really use flat items, as you don't want glasses toppling over because the surface area is not flush! ;) Die cuts and stickers are great.
Take a corner rounder and round the edges if you like.

Now, I wanted my coasters to be water resistant. I could do a few layers of the sealer, but I didn't want the surface of my coasters to be sticky. I tried to laminate them... too fat for a decent seal. So I settled on my nemesis... contact paper!
(I have a roll that was banished to the back of the wardrobe after numerous unsuccessful attempts at covering my Son's school books in 2012!)

* Cut your contact to size and adhere to the front and back, pressing well 
to iron out any air bubbles. Trim the excess around the corners 
with some scissors or a craft knife.
I gave the edges of the coasters a bit of a seal with the decoupage glue, and once dry, coloured them with a gold marker. One more quick seal coat (use a fine paintbrush) and we are ready to rock and roll!
